Frequently Asked Questions about Little Rock
How much are Studio apartments in Little Rock?
There are currently 161 Studio Apartments in Little Rock with rent ranges from $680 to $2,150 with an average price of $1,019.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Little Rock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Little Rock ranges from $500 to $2,400 with an average monthly rent of $1,073.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Little Rock c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Little Rock range from $625 to $3,555.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,224.
How expensive are Little Rock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 139 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Little Rock on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$695 to $6,560 - averaging $1,581 for the location.
